If it's of any help amid the plethora of glasspacks, the Smithys are not very loud, but have a very nice mellow rumble. My pick if you want a nice mellow sound. If you want a bit louder and more "hotrod" then Porters are beautiful. A little bit of snarl. My pick for louder packs. I have no experience of Brockmans, so do not know where they sit.
Remember that pipe size in, pipe size out, and where in the pipe the muffler is situated all determines the sound. The good thing is that you can quieten them down if they're too loud by situating them closer to the engine, plus using a smaller tail pipe. And vice versa if too quiet.
Also remember that a rappy exhaust is OK around town, but may drive you nuts on a long trip.
